In 2010, Joseph McStay (age 40), and his wife Summer (age 43), lived in Fallbrook, California, with their sons Gianni (age 4) and Joseph Jr. (age 3). [8], On February 4, 2010, at 7:47pm, a neighbor's surveillance system captured the bottom eighteen inches of a vehicle, thought at the time to be the McStay family's 1996 Isuzu Trooper. The bodies of Joseph McStay, 40, and his wife Summer, 43, along with their sons Gianni, 4, and Joseph Jr., 3, were found in a shallow grave in the desert north of Victorville in 2013. And when we were out she would call him constantly. Soon, the family's car was found at a strip mall in south San Diego County near the U.S.-Mexico border. [6] Joseph owned and operated Earth Inspired Products, a company that built decorative fountains, and Summer was a licensed real estate agent.
